Abstract

A method to rectify any type of material by means of any type of rectifying tool, using instruments to measure quantities and chemical and physical characteristics and, connected to the aforementioned equipment, auxiliary devices, analyzers, regulators and, eventually, adaptive regulation systems of actual dimensions and surface finish, frequency analyzers for the measurement of mechanical vibrations and acoustic waves to obtain limit values, and treatment computers are also eventually required so that the user can adaptively adjust technically and economically the grinding processes of the different types, consisting of the aforementioned method in which the instruments for measurement are aimed at the flow of matter and energy emanating from the contact area between the grinding tool or tool and the the workpiece, whose flow is the carrier of the info Continuously available information regarding energy conversion and the course of events in the grinding process.
